Ok basilcly what I'm doing is keeping the same standered strut in there.
but I'm using a short little gas shock like the shock in the pic.
what you do is attach the bottom of the shock to the control arm, by bolting it on, not welding, and the circle bit on the bottom of the shock will slide over a metal rod, which is attached to the control arm.
It can still have plenty of movement. with the top of the shock ill use a peice of angle steel like 90 degreas angle and weld that onto the the inside part of the wheel arch. once that is on you just bolt the top of the shock to the angle iron.
